See photographs https://inuit.net/artists/b-inuitarteskimoart-Papialuk_Josie-Pamiutu.html Josie Pamiutu Papialuk (1918-1996), Puvirnituq (Povungnituk) Born: 1918 Deceased: 1996 Male E9-861 Place of Birth: near Issuksiuvit Lake Resides: Puvirnituq Sculpture, Drawings, Prints Josie Pamiutu Papialuk, known also as "Josie Paperk" or simply "Puppy," was born in 1918 near Issuksiuvit Lake, just inland from Povungnituk. After the death of his wife Martha in 1975, he continued to live there with his only surviving son. Josie is a very jovial man, regarded in the community as an eccentric joker. His art is indicative of a special kind of genius: it reveals both his profound sense of observation and a keen insight. Josie produces both carvings and prints. He was one of the first Povungnituk artists to become involved in printmaking in the early 1960s. Initially, he produced small, whimsical soapstone carvings of birds, fish and human heads.
